Output ec76308af784e18d28827b37aa1c53d2c8288d43f3b7401ac7577561db2ffd63:43

value
382653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d72474ddcdd1eb1a2ed863bd65ae71622f0df76 OP_EQUAL
address
3AD7fbVmmLiyxTwpJrTpWUiVtdGTgDagNp
transaction
ec76308af784e18d28827b37aa1c53d2c8288d43f3b7401ac7577561db2ffd63
spent
true